141 Speedway WDLMA Late Models Rescheduled For July 28
by Joe Verdegan
7/15/2010
"NORTH VERSUS SOUTH" CIVIL WAR GRUDGE MATCH ALSO RESET
(Francis Creek, WI) July 15 - 141 Speedway in Francis Creek has announced that the Wisconsin Dirt Late Model Association late models (WDLMA) will make an appearance at the high-banked third mile, clay oval on Wednesday night, July 28.
The show is a raindate for the show scheduled for July 14 that was washed out.
The IMCA hobby stocks scheduled appearance for the night has been cancelled.
It will be the second appearance of the season for the WDLMA late models at Wisconsin's newest dirt track, following the largest crowd of the year June 16 when Waukesha's Rick Scheffler bested the
field of 28 late models. "We thought for our first appearance the
staff there treated us great and the facilities are top notch," said WDLMA president Bill Behling. "And when we called everyone about the raindate, most everyone was for it. It should work out well for both parties."
The night will be highlighted by a 25 lap feature, which pays $1,200
to win. In addition, a special "Civil War" 10 lap grudge race will
take place, featuring the racing family Scheffler's versus the Anvelink's.
The Scheffler brothers Russ and Rick will race their WDLMA cars against the father-son team of Terry and Nick Anvelink. The special grudge race is sponsored by Behling Circle Track Equipment of Butler and B & B Race Engines of Appleton.
Not to be outdone are the track's weekly classes, which will be IMCA modifieds, northern sportmods, stock cars and sport fours which will
compete in a full program. The pit area opens at 4 p.m. The spectator
gates open at 5 p.m. The first green flag flies at 7 p.m.
